428504-10-3,692872-46-1,388596-70-1,388596-74-5,20812-67-3,63829-17-4 Supplier | CHEMEXPLORE.CN
CMO CDMO service. CHEMEXPLORE.CN supply 428504-10-3,692872-46-1,388596-70-1,388596-74-5,20812-67-3,63829-17-4 and related compounds.
20812-67-3 388596-74-5 428504-10-3 692872-46-1 63829-17-4 388596-70-1